The impact of a mindfulness practice on the coach’s experience of countertransference: A thematic analysis

This study explores how mindfulness practice influences coaches’ experiences of countertransference, from the perspective of the coach. Method: It uses thematic analysis to analyse the data. Nine coaches participated in the study, all of whom had three or more years of coaching and mindfulness experience and a theoretical understanding of countertransference. Semi-structured interviews were used for data collection. Results: Results indicated that mindfulness practice had an impact on coaches’ experience of countertransference when working with a client; in particular, enhanced somatic cognisance, awareness, and self-regulation capabilities. Three themes with related subthemes emerged from the key findings: somatic significance, coaching with full awareness, and self-regulation strategies, all of which appear to support coaches’ ability to identify and manage countertransference. Discussion: Findings are explored and discussed in the context of countertransference and mindfulness with reference to existing theoretical and empirical studies. Theories on embodiment, self-reflection, self-regulation and therapeutical presence are considered useful frameworks through which to interpret findings. Limitations of the study and suggestions for future research are noted. Conclusion: Mindfulness practice can contribute to the personal and professional development of the coach thereby impacting the coach’s capacity to recognise and productively manage the experience of countertransference, which can strengthen the coaching alliance.
